Without caring about the building anymore, Bill broke the stones and flew up the stairs, catching up with Henzo just as he was exiting the tunnel.

Grabbing him by the shirt with one hand, Bill rose high into the sky and, when they were several hundred feet above the city, shouted:

— You old fool! Were you trying to kill someone with your traps?!

- AAAAA!!! - Henzo screamed, looking from Bill to the ground, turning pale as a sheet.

"So?!" Bill shouted again, because he knew that most of the other people would have already been killed by Henzo's traps.

But his anger subsided slightly when he saw the old man standing with his mouth open and his eyes full of horror.

Bill shook his head, calmed down and said:

"Easy there, old man. I'm not going to drop you. Just keep your hands out there, I'll feel it if you start moving!"

Having said this, Bill pulled Henzo closer to him and, using the Moon Step, quickly headed towards the top of the island's main mountain.

The air was colder here, but not dangerously cold. When Bill set Henzo down, the old man swallowed deeply and said,

- Y...you really did fly from the sky!

Hearing this, Bill chuckled and said:

"It's just a Marine technique. Now, old man, why did you try to kill me?"

"I... I didn't mean to kill anyone!" Henzo stuttered. "I just... I was running for my life!"

After a few more questions, Bill discovered that only Wetton knew about Henzo's lab, and the visit in the middle of the night had come as a complete surprise to him.

Since Bill was the one who had invaded his home, he decided to drop the subject and moved on to discussing Wetton's piratical activities.

To his slight surprise, Henzo admitted that he knew Wetton was a pirate:

- Yes, then he ordered the city to be burned... My friends and I wanted to escape the island and call for help, so we tried to steal his ship.

"We were so close," Henzo rubbed his eyes and spoke in a deeper voice, "But he caught us as soon as we set sail... Of course, we tried to fight back, even now, fifty years later, I remember Rapa fighting him. But we were just kids... When another pirate came on board, I thought we were done for, but then I saw my chance and took it.

Looking straight at Bill, the old man said:

"I knocked Wetton off the ship, and we fell into the water. From there, we saw the Rainbow Mist descend, and the ship disappeared before our eyes.

Hearing this story, Bill truly felt sorry for Henzo. If the attack had occurred fifty years ago, then the old man before him would have been just a child at the time.

Bill didn't blame Henzo for collaborating with Wetton, since the guy probably had no choice after he lost everything else.

Trying to keep his tone neutral, Bill sat down on a large rock and said,

- So your friends died during the attack... And what about the city's residents, how many of them...

— They're not dead! They were caught in the Monkey Concert!

The interruption at this point did not bother Bill at all, and Henzo continued:

"Most of the citizens survived the attack... Whatever Wetton had planned for the city, he changed his plans when he saw the Rainbow Mist. Fifty years later, not many remain who remember that our 'mayor' was actually our Conqueror..."

Nodding at this, Bill asked the next question, for only someone who had lived long enough could truly understand what "fifty years" meant:

— What about the soldiers? Are they still active pirates?

Shaking his head, Henzo explained:

"These are the grandchildren of Wetton's original crew. They train for combat and fend off raiders, but other than collecting taxes, they've never seen actual combat."

Bill wasn't surprised to hear they were repelling raiders. He already knew that on islands outside the kingdoms, security was always questionable at best.

Growing up on Vallipo, he was struck by how much people trusted the World Government, so much so that the town sheriff happily signed his only son up to serve as an errand boy. But after sailing the seas, Bill began to understand.

Most of the islands did not have a large enough population to support a strong military force, and so they were always under threat of pirate raids.

"Frontier" justice could never adequately protect these remote islands from the multitude of pirate crews who could attack at any moment and then flee. Therefore, the marines were considered the only force capable of defending them.

On islands like Little East Blue, Clock Island, or Ruluk, the lack of a marine presence demonstrated the dangers that the average person faced in this world.

However, when it came to mass murder and looting, Bill wouldn't let Wetton off the hook simply because so much time had passed. So he asked how many soldiers Wetton had and whether they were prepared to fight the Marines.

Bill learned that although the soldiers numbered around 450, they lived in barracks and had families on the island. Wetton truly intended to settle down, and despite the high taxes driving people into poverty, life wasn't so unbearable that it was impossible for them to survive.
